Once the server is connected, just ask in plain English — the agent picks the tools. The examples below show the typical tool path so you know what each question costs and where the answer comes from.

Unusual activity

Were there any unusual bullish sweeps on TSLA today?
flow_search (confirm ticker) → sweeps and/or unusual_volume, filtered to calls. The agent summarizes premium, venues, and Flow Score.
Which tickers had the most unusual options volume this week, excluding the indices?
unusual_volume with exclude_tickers=SPY,QQQ,IWM — or top_contracts_weekly for a premium-ranked list.

Directional read on a name

Is the flow on NVDA bullish or bearish right now, and how strong?
aggregate_score (Composite + VWF/SDF/FIR across timeframes), often paired with flow_momentum for a “vs baseline” read and chain_bull_bear to separate call buying from put selling.
Show me where the premium is concentrated by strike on SPY this afternoon.
flow_strikes (or by_strike) over the session window.

Positioning & accumulation

Is the OTM call activity on AMD new positioning or closing flow?
vol_oi (accumulation score + new-position estimate) and unusual_oi (opening vs closing direction).
What does the AAPL chain look like for the Jan 17 expiration?
expirations (find the date) → option_chain for that expiration.

Market-wide

What’s the overall market tone today — risk-on or risk-off?
market_breadth for the one-line read, market_overview and market_tide for the supporting detail.
Which sector is seeing the strongest call flow?
market_breadth (per-sector rotation) → sector_flow to drill into the leader.

Dealer positioning (Heatseeker)

Where are the gamma walls on SPY right now?
heat_heatmap for the current per-strike gamma exposure + live velocity.
What did the SPY gamma profile look like at the open on March 5?
heat_historical_heatmap with at=2026-03-05T14:30:00Z.

Combining both products

SPY has a gamma wall at 600 — is the flow defending it or pushing through?
heat_heatmap (locate the wall) → flow_strikes / flow_tide around that strike to see whether premium is accumulating into or fading away from it. This pairing — positioning from Heatseeker, intent from Flowseeker — is the core reason the two products share one gateway and one key.
Agents work best when you give them a ticker and a timeframe. “TSLA, last hour” beats “show me some flow.” If a result looks empty, ask the agent to widen the window or lower the min_premium filter.
